Common Names

  • Tradescantia Sillamontana
  • White Velvet
  • Cobweb Spiderwort

Botanical Classification

  • Kingdom: Plantae
  • Order: Commelinales
  • Family: Commelinaceae
  • Genus: Tradescantia
  • Species: T. sillamontana

Where It Comes From

Tradescantia Sillamontana is native to the arid mountains of northeastern Mexico. Its ability to thrive in dry conditions and intense sunlight makes it a resilient and adaptable addition to both indoor and outdoor plant collections.

A Plant with Texture and Contrast

This variety stands out with its cobweb-like leaf hairs and compact, geometric growth. The contrast between its fuzzy foliage and its bold purple flowers makes it a perfect candidate for modern, bohemian, or tropical-inspired designs.

What Does It Look Like?

White Velvet features thick, ovate leaves densely covered in white fuzz that helps it retain moisture. The plant grows low and spreads or trails beautifully over pot edges or ground covers. In summer, vibrant magenta-purple flowers bloom at the tips, creating a stunning contrast against the silver foliage.

Dealing with Pests

Tradescantia Sillamontana is generally pest-resistant but can occasionally suffer from mealybugs or spider mites, especially in dry indoor air. Use neem oil or insecticidal soap and keep humidity moderate to deter infestations. Wipe leaves occasionally to keep them clean and healthy.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can Tradescantia Sillamontana be grown indoors?

Absolutely! It adapts well to indoor conditions if provided with bright, indirect sunlight and well-draining soil.

How often should I water it?

Water only when the top inch of soil feels dry. It's drought-tolerant, so avoid overwatering.

Does it flower indoors?

With adequate light, it can bloom indoors during the warmer months, producing vivid purple flowers.

Is it safe for pets?

Tradescantia plants may cause mild irritation if ingested by pets, so it's best to keep them out of reach.

Sun: Indirect

Place near a sunny window where it gets medium to bright light daily. Insufficient light may cause leggy growth and faded foliage.

Light: Medium - Bright

They enjoy a bit of direct sun but thrive best in bright, indirect light. Morning sun or dappled afternoon light is ideal for keeping the velvet leaves vibrant and healthy.

Water: When mostly dry

Allow the soil to dry out 70–80% between waterings. Overwatering can lead to root rot—use well-draining soil and pots with drainage holes.

Humidity: Any

Tradescantia White Velvet is not picky about humidity, making it great for average indoor environments. Avoid placing it near heaters or vents.

Pet Friendly: Caution

Tradescantia White Velvet is mildly toxic if ingested. Keep it out of reach of curious pets and kids.

Pro Tip

Pinch back the growing tips regularly to encourage a fuller, bushier shape and prevent legginess. Rotate the plant weekly to promote even growth.
